We are proud of working on made-in-Lithuania products and are looking for a Head of Human Resources Department to contribute to successful growth of Teltonika Networks.
THE MAIN AREAS OF RESPONSIBILITY
- Actively participate in the implementation and improvement of HR policy aligned with the overall strategy of the group of companies;
- Implementing organization’s HR strategies and goals;
- Managing the recruitment and selection process;
- Ensuring a smooth onboarding process;
- Supervising IoT and B2B training academies;
- Overseeing and managing employee competencies, performance review, training and career management process;
- Organizing team building, task coordination and training for team members;
- Budget planning and controlling;
- Formation of company culture and values and communication management;
- Monitoring and evaluating HR metrics;
- Collaboration with managers.
